If your employer does not provide online access to your W-2, they must mail or hand-deliver your … fifi folding chairWebEach year, employers must send Copy A of Forms W-2 (Wage and Tax Statement) to Social Security to report the wages and taxes of your employees for the previous calendar year. In addition, a Form W-2 must be given to each employee. Forms W-2 are sent to Social Security along with a Form W-3 (Transmittal of Income and Tax Statements). fifi flowertots dvdWebDec 4, 2024 · You can use Schedule SE (Form 1040) to figure out how much tax is due on your self-employment net earnings.
